RECLAMATION PLAN EXHIBIT E <br />11 <br /> <br />1. General Reclamation Plan <br />Mining Area 1 has 7.1 acres of reclaimed area and Mining Area 2 has 13.9 acres of reclaimed <br />area. Prior to mining, the site existed as a weedy, abandoned field with lots of tamarisk, Russian <br />olive, knapweed, and perennial grasses. As much as possible, the wetland and riparian areas will <br />be avoided during mining. Most areas disturbed by mining will be reclaimed as lakes. Some <br />wetlands will be created along the edge of the lakes. Dryland slopes will be created uphill of the <br />wetlands. Disturbed ground outside the lake and perimeter wetlands will be reclaimed as dry <br />rangeland. Disturbance around the pits will be caused by the installation of topsoil stockpiles, <br />overburden stockpiles, and water handling structures such as berms arid ditches. To minimize <br />final reclamation tasks, mining phases will be promptly reclaimed after mining has been <br />completed. See Visual Impact section of mining plan for details. Final reclamation tasks for the <br />pit will include: backfilling Area 2-Phase 4 and rough grading, final grading of slopes for Scott <br />Expansion Area 2-Phase 4, topsoiling of Area 2-Phase 4 and dry rangeland seeding of Area 2- <br />Phase 4 and wetland seeding of Area 2. No backfilling will take place in the minor wetland <br />footprint within Mining Area 2, since this wetland is disturbed under the US Army Corps of <br />Engineers Tulloch rule which only allows excavation within a wetland. It should be noted that <br />fringe wetlands to be restored far exceed wetland areas to be disturbed.
